Challenge

Our client, a global manufacturing company, was grappling with persistent process control issues that were creating inefficiencies and increasing production costs.  Operators struggled with the complex process which requires manual intervention, leading to production inefficiencies. 

The client identified several critical issues:

  • Difficult-to-modify Distributed Control Systems (DCS) with cumbersome mimics
  • Over-reliance on operator skill and attention, resulting in inconsistent plant operation and reduced throughput 
  • Inability to forecast and monitor remaining running times for each sequence or be alerted to potential clashes
  • No appetite for process downtime, re-commissioning, or large capital expenditures
  • Incredibly complicated process that has many components and sequences that run asynchronously but share the same process streams with less than desirable observability.

CapitalAI Solution

CapitalAI was approached by the client due to our unique understanding of industrial systems and processes as well as our experience in utilising operational data. CapitalAI deployed its state-of-the-art NexAI platform to address the client’s operational challenges. This big data platform leverages operational data from connected IoT devices, machines, vehicles, and DCS systems to provide comprehensive insights and optimise processes.
